Mirroring - Get Tables Mirroring Status
รับสถานะการมิเรอร์ของตาราง
API นี้สนับสนุน การแบ่งหน้า
สิทธิ์
ผู้เรียกต้องมีสิทธิ์ การอ่าน สําหรับฐานข้อมูลแบบมิเรอร์
จําเป็นต้องมีขอบเขตที่ได้รับมอบสิทธิ์
MirroredDatabase.Read.All หรือ MirroredDatabase.ReadWrite.All หรือ Item.Read.All หรือ Item.ReadWrite.All
ข้อมูลประจําตัวที่สนับสนุนของ Microsoft Entra
API นี้สนับสนุนข้อมูลประจําตัวของ Microsoft แสดงรายการในส่วนนี้
| เอกลักษณ์ | สนับสนุน |
|---|---|
| ผู้ใช้ | ใช่ |
| บริการหลักและข้อมูลประจําตัว ที่มีการจัดการ | ใช่ |
อิน เทอร์ เฟซ
POST https://api.fabric.microsoft.com/v1/workspaces/{workspaceId}/mirroredDatabases/{mirroredDatabaseId}/getTablesMirroringStatus
POST https://api.fabric.microsoft.com/v1/workspaces/{workspaceId}/mirroredDatabases/{mirroredDatabaseId}/getTablesMirroringStatus?continuationToken={continuationToken}
พารามิเตอร์ URI
| ชื่อ | ใน | จำเป็น | พิมพ์ | คำอธิบาย |
|---|---|---|---|---|
|
mirrored
|
path | True |
string (uuid) |
ID ฐานข้อมูลที่มิเรอร์ |
|
workspace
|
path | True |
string (uuid) |
ID พื้นที่ทํางาน |
|
continuation
|
query |
string |
โทเค็นสําหรับการเรียกใช้หน้าถัดไปของผลลัพธ์ |
การตอบสนอง
| ชื่อ | พิมพ์ | คำอธิบาย |
|---|---|---|
| 200 OK |
คําขอเสร็จสมบูรณ์ |
|
| Other Status Codes |
รหัสข้อผิดพลาดทั่วไป:
|
ตัวอย่าง
Get tables mirroring status example
คำขอตัวอย่าง
POST https://api.fabric.microsoft.com/v1/workspaces/a0a0a0a0-bbbb-cccc-dddd-e1e1e1e1e1e1/mirroredDatabases/b1b1b1b1-cccc-dddd-eeee-f2f2f2f2f2f2/getTablesMirroringStatus
คำตอบตัวอย่าง
{
"data": [
{
"sourceObjectType": "Table",
"sourceSchemaName": "dbo",
"sourceTableName": "test",
"status": "Replicating",
"metrics": {
"processedBytes": 1247,
"processedRows": 6,
"lastSyncDateTime": "2024-10-08T05:07:11.0663362Z",
"lastSyncLatencyInSeconds": 15
}
}
]
}
คำจำกัดความ
| ชื่อ | คำอธิบาย |
|---|---|
|
Error |
ออบเจ็กต์รายละเอียดทรัพยากรที่เกี่ยวข้องกับข้อผิดพลาด |
|
Error |
การตอบสนองข้อผิดพลาด |
|
Error |
รายละเอียดการตอบสนองข้อผิดพลาด |
|
Table |
เมตริกการมิเรอร์ตาราง |
|
Table |
ชนิดสถานะการมิเรอร์ตาราง ประเภท |
|
Table |
การตอบสนองสถานะการมิเรอร์ตาราง |
|
Tables |
รายการสถานะการมิเรอร์ตารางที่มีการแบ่งหน้า |
|
Table |
ชนิดออบเจ็กต์ต้นทางของตาราง ประเภท |
ErrorRelatedResource
ออบเจ็กต์รายละเอียดทรัพยากรที่เกี่ยวข้องกับข้อผิดพลาด
| ชื่อ | พิมพ์ | คำอธิบาย |
|---|---|---|
| resourceId |
string |
ID ทรัพยากรที่เกี่ยวข้องกับข้อผิดพลาด |
| resourceType |
string |
ชนิดของทรัพยากรที่เกี่ยวข้องกับข้อผิดพลาด |
ErrorResponse
การตอบสนองข้อผิดพลาด
| ชื่อ | พิมพ์ | คำอธิบาย |
|---|---|---|
| errorCode |
string |
ตัวระบุเฉพาะที่ให้ข้อมูลเกี่ยวกับเงื่อนไขข้อผิดพลาด ทําให้สามารถสื่อสารได้มาตรฐานระหว่างบริการของเรากับผู้ใช้ |
| message |
string |
การแสดงข้อผิดพลาดที่มนุษย์สามารถอ่านได้ |
| moreDetails |
รายการรายละเอียดข้อผิดพลาดเพิ่มเติม |
|
| relatedResource |
รายละเอียดทรัพยากรที่เกี่ยวข้องกับข้อผิดพลาด |
|
| requestId |
string |
รหัสของคําขอที่เกี่ยวข้องกับข้อผิดพลาด |
ErrorResponseDetails
รายละเอียดการตอบสนองข้อผิดพลาด
| ชื่อ | พิมพ์ | คำอธิบาย |
|---|---|---|
| errorCode |
string |
ตัวระบุเฉพาะที่ให้ข้อมูลเกี่ยวกับเงื่อนไขข้อผิดพลาด ทําให้สามารถสื่อสารได้มาตรฐานระหว่างบริการของเรากับผู้ใช้ |
| message |
string |
การแสดงข้อผิดพลาดที่มนุษย์สามารถอ่านได้ |
| relatedResource |
รายละเอียดทรัพยากรที่เกี่ยวข้องกับข้อผิดพลาด |
TableMirroringMetrics
เมตริกการมิเรอร์ตาราง
| ชื่อ | พิมพ์ | คำอธิบาย |
|---|---|---|
| lastSyncDateTime |
string (date-time) |
เวลาประมวลผลล่าสุดของตารางใน UTC โดยใช้รูปแบบ YYYY-MM-DDTHH:mm:ssZ |
| lastSyncLatencyInSeconds |
integer (int32) |
เวลาแฝงในหน่วยวินาทีระหว่างเวลาการยอมรับต้นทางและเวลาการยอมรับเป้าหมายของการเปลี่ยนแปลงที่ประมวลผลครั้งล่าสุด สําหรับแหล่งข้อมูลที่เวลาการยอมรับต้นทางไม่พร้อมใช้งาน ค่านี้จะไม่ถูกส่งกลับ |
| processedBytes |
integer (int64) |
ไบต์ที่ประมวลผลสําหรับตารางนี้ |
| processedRows |
integer (int64) |
จํานวนแถวที่ประมวลผลสําหรับตารางนี้ |
TableMirroringStatus
ชนิดสถานะการมิเรอร์ตาราง ประเภท TableMirroringStatus เพิ่มเติมอาจเพิ่มเมื่อเวลาผ่านไป
| ค่า | คำอธิบาย |
|---|---|
| Initialized |
มีการเตรียมใช้งาน Mirroing ของตาราง |
| Snapshotting |
ตารางกําลังสแนปช็อต |
| Replicating |
ตารางกําลังจําลองแบบ |
| Reseeding |
ตารางถูกประดับอยู่ |
| Stopped |
การทํามิเรอร์ของตารางจะหยุดลง |
| Failed |
การ Mirroing ของตารางล้มเหลวโดยมีข้อผิดพลาด |
TableMirroringStatusResponse
การตอบสนองสถานะการมิเรอร์ตาราง
| ชื่อ | พิมพ์ | คำอธิบาย |
|---|---|---|
| error |
ข้อผิดพลาดระดับตารางได้รับการตั้งค่าถ้าเกิดข้อผิดพลาดในการมิเรอร์ตารางนี้ |
|
| metrics |
เมตริกการมิเรอร์ของตาราง |
|
| sourceObjectType |
ชนิดออบเจ็กต์ต้นทาง |
|
| sourceSchemaName |
string |
ชื่อเค้าร่างตารางต้นทาง |
| sourceTableName |
string |
ชื่อตารางต้นทาง |
| status |
ชนิดสถานะการมิเรอร์ของตาราง |
TablesMirroringStatusResponse
รายการสถานะการมิเรอร์ตารางที่มีการแบ่งหน้า
| ชื่อ | พิมพ์ | คำอธิบาย |
|---|---|---|
| continuationToken |
string |
โทเค็นสําหรับชุดผลลัพธ์ชุดถัดไป ถ้าไม่มีระเบียนเพิ่มเติม จะถูกลบออกจากการตอบสนอง |
| continuationUri |
string |
URI ของชุดงานชุดผลลัพธ์ถัดไป ถ้าไม่มีระเบียนเพิ่มเติม จะถูกลบออกจากการตอบสนอง |
| data |
รายการของสถานะการมิเรอร์ตาราง |
TableSourceObjectType
ชนิดออบเจ็กต์ต้นทางของตาราง ประเภท TableSourceObjectType เพิ่มเติมอาจเพิ่มเมื่อเวลาผ่านไป
| ค่า | คำอธิบาย |
|---|---|
| Table |
ชนิดของตาราง |
| View |
ชนิดของมุมมอง |